Lee Johnson makes two changes to his last league line-up as the City head coach returns to former club Barnsley for the first time (3pm).
Wide men Jamie Paterson and Luke Freeman (ankle) drop out, replaced by Bobby Reid and Aaron Wilbraham as Johnson switches to 4-4-2 with a narrow midfield.
Scott Golbourne continues ahead of Joe Bryan at left-back, while Callum O’Dowda is missing through illness.
Barnsley: Davies, Bree, Yiadom, McDonald, Jackson, Kay, Morsy, Watkins, Kent, Winnall, Armstrong. Subs: Townsend, Kpekawa, Evans, Williams, Lee, Hammill, Bradshaw.
Bristol City: Fielding, Matthews, Flint, Magnusson, Golbourne, O’Neil, K.Smith, Reid, Tomlin, Wilbraham, Abraham. Subs: O’Donnell, Moore, Bryan, Pack, Brownhill, Paterson, Engvall.
Referee: Mr G Eltringham.
